Online language courses with immersive components leverage digital platforms to teach new languages through interactive, real-world simulation techniques. These courses often incorporate virtual reality (VR), augmented reality (AR), live conversations with native speakers, cultural immersion activities, and scenario-based learning to enhance comprehension and speaking skills in an engaging, flexible environment.

Pros
- Highly engaging and interactive learning experience
- Offers realistic language practice through immersive scenarios
- Enhances listening and speaking skills effectively
- Provides cultural insights that deepen understanding of the language context
- Flexibility allows learners to study at their own pace
Cons
- Requires access to advanced technology like VR/AR devices, which can be costly
- May have a steep learning curve for less tech-savvy users
- Quality and effectiveness can vary across different platforms or providers
- Limited availability of live native speaker sessions in some courses
- Potentially higher cost compared to traditional online courses
